Helsinky Morizon

Dog Trainer (specialising in K9 psychology).

Helsinky grew up with a family who trained competition level obedience German Shepherds. Later on she worked on a cattle station mustering cattle with horses and 12 working dogs.

She later discovered she had a special intuitive gift with dogs when she got involved with rescue dogs.

The first dog she rehabilitated was one of her rescued Bull Arabs “Bowie” who had had several owners before her. He had been in a shelter for a year and came with severe aggression issues and some redirected aggression to humans.

This dog would’ve been put down had Helsinky hadn’t committed herself to rehabilitate him and bring him back to balance.

He is the one dog who inspired her to start helping other people with their reactive/aggressive dogs along with her other Bull Arab “Sassy’s” help. Bowie has since helped rehabilitating other rescue dogs and is up for the challenge to help rehabilitate many more.
